Read the text and fill in the gaps with the correct form of verbs as per subject and context.
It is natural that a man cannot (a) _____ (live) alonE- He always (b) _____ (need) a company. He has to (c) _____ (express) his thought and ideas, (d) _____ (think) others while the others (e) _____ (be) of the same needs. He (f) _____ (have) also the need of others for (g) _____ (ensure) their safety and comfort. So, he is bound (h) _____ (live) with others (i) _____ (make) an institution and it (j) _____ (call) society. Society (k) _____ (be) the first organization which (l) _____ (make) by our primitive ancestors. They (m) _____ (be) the first to contribute to (n) _____ (develop) the civilization.
(a) live; (b) needs; (c) express; (d) think; (e) are; (f) has; (g) ensuring; (h) to live; (i) making; (j) is called; (k) is; (l) was made; (m) were; (n) developing.
